Radio personality Howard Stern put anti-vaxxers on blast during his Sirius XM show earlier this week, calling them "imbeciles" and "nutjobs." On Tuesday's episode of The Howard Stern Show, the popular shock jock launched into a tirade against people who refuse to take the Covid vaccine, thereby potentially putting others at risk, and even went so far as to suggest that vaccinations become enforced.

"When are we going to stop putting up with the idiots in this country and just say, you know, it’s mandatory to get vaccinated?" He said. "Fuck them, fuck their freedom. I want my freedom to live. I want to get out of the house already. I want to go next door and play chess. I want to go take some pictures. This is bullshit... I'll tell you what, far as I remember, when I went to school you had to get a measles vaccine, you had to get a mumps vaccine."

"The other thing I hate is that all these people with Covid who won't get vaccinated are in the hospitals clogging it up," he continued. "Like, if you have a heart attack or any kind of problem, you can't even get into the E.R. And I'm really of a mind to say, 'Look, if you didn't get vaccinated, you got COVID, you don't get into a hospital.'"

He went on to openly mock Conservative broadcasters Mark Bernier, Dick Farrel, Phil Valentine and Tod Tucker, all outspoken opponents of the vaccine who then contracted Covid and ultimately died.

“Four of them were like ranting on the air, they will not get vaccinated," said Stern. "They were on fire, these guys. It was like day after day, they were all dying and then their dying words are 'I wish I had been more into the vaccine. I wish I had taken it'... Go fuck yourself. You had the cure and you wouldn't take it."
